Xiaomi Mi 6 Joins the Ranks of 10nm

Xiaomi has taken the curtains off their flagship Mi 6. Mi 6 will be the first phone by the Chinese company powered by the 10nm Qualcomm Snapdragon 835 platform with 6GB RAM and up to 128GB storage.

Crafted like a watch, Mi 6 integrates four-sided 3D curved glass and a stainless steel frame. It is available in three colours (Black, White and Blue) as well as two special editions: Ceramic and Silver.

Compared to the last-generation Snapdragon 820, Snapdragon 835 is 35 percent smaller in package size and consumes 25 percent less power, giving a longer battery life on Mi 6. The phone is decked out with an octa-core processor with four performance cores running at up to 2.45 GHz. The Adreno 540 GPU contributes to a 25 percent performance improvement, and supports the latest Vulkan graphics API.

The dual camera setup on Mi 6 comes with wide angle and telephoto lenses. The 2x optical zoom and 10x digital zoom makes sure photos of distant subjects remain clear. The camera has a four-axis OIS so images and videos remain sharp, reducing the effect of handshake or motion. The dual camera setup allows for a depth of field effect, while the Beautify mode for selfies works with the rear camera as well on Mi 6.

 

Mi 6 comes with 6GB of LPDDR4x RAM, with options of 64GB or 128GB storage. A compact 5.15-inch device that comes with a large 3350mAh battery, it boasts higher power efficiency due to the 10nm CPU coupled with MIUI optimizations. This means that Mi 6 will easily last users an entire day on a single charge.

The display allow the brightness level to start at a much lower level, with 4096 levels of brightness that can be tweaked at 0.15nit a level, compared to devices with 256 levels of brightness that only changes 2.3nit at each level. There is also a blue light filter while keeping the screen less yellow, achieving a more natural look.

The 2×2 802.11ac MU-MIMO Wi-Fi enhances Mi 6’s wireless performance, enabling better reception indoors, with fewer blind spots.

Mi 6 will be available starting 28 April across Mi.com, Mi Home stores, and other partner sites. The 6GB + 64GB version is priced at RMB 2,499 (approx. RM1600) , the 6GB + 128GB version is priced at RMB 2,899 (approx. RM1900) and the Ceramic edition is priced at RMB 2,999 (approx RM 2000). Global release is set for a later date.

Specs:

 

  •  Qualcomm Snapdragon 835 with 10nm process technology (Octa-core, max 2.45GHz)
  •  All-new Kryo 280 microarchitecture, Adreno 540 GPU
  •  184292 AnTuTu score
  •  Dual camera, optical zoom:
    •  12MP wide angle with 4-axis OIS stabilization + 12MP telephoto o Exceptional portrait photography with background blur
    •  Beautify, for natural selfie enhancements
  •  5.15” display with reduced glare, precise 0.15-nit adjustments (total 4096 brightness levels)
  •  Four-sided 3D curved glass body, high-gloss stainless steel frame
  •  145.17 x 70.49 x 7.45mm
  •  6GB LPDDR4x RAM + 64GB or 128GB storage
  •  3350mAh high-capacity battery, full-day usage
  •  Stereo speakers, immersive video and gaming experience
  •  Under-glass front fingerprint sensor
  •  Splash-resistant, USB Type-C charging
  •  Full NFC functionality: Read, write, card emulation
  •  Available in Black, White, Blue and Silver
  •  Available in Ceramic with 18-karat gold camera rims
